U.S. Gazetteer Places (2000):
Jersey City, NJ -- U.S. city in New Jersey
   Population (2000):    240055
   Housing Units (2000): 93648
   Land area (2000):     14.916045 sq. miles (38.632377 sq. km)
   Water area (2000):    6.195422 sq. miles (16.046068 sq. km)
   Total area (2000):    21.111467 sq. miles (54.678445 sq. km)
   FIPS code:            36000
   Located within:       New Jersey (NJ), FIPS 34
   Location:             40.722102 N, 74.065385 W
   ZIP Codes (1990):     07302 07304 07305 07306 07307 07310
